I think the answer is it’s hard to keep a group of four or five people together in any enterprise for a lengthy period of time. Even if you ignore that music probably attracts a higher proportion of highly strung personalities.

In a group of four there are six “bilateral” relationships that need to be kept on a positive working level. Simon and Garfunkel couldn’t hold it together with one relationship. So there’s a lot of opportunities for problems to arise.. If a band isn’t successful it will break up as members look for better options. At the other end, a rich and famous band might break up because they can. There’s less incentive to keep going if you’re financially secure and there’s any problems between band members. Even aside from just boredom of doing the same thing with the same people over and over. 

Even bands that stay together rarely do so without significant membership changes. U2 and a few others such as ZZ  Top and Rush are the exception. That supports the notion that it’s just hard keeping people together.

I've never been in a serious band setting for very long and the ones I have been in we all went in knowing it wasnt going to last for various reasons anyways.  I have played with a ton of people however and its pretty easy to see why bands break up over time.  Lets face it, a lot of times you just dont click with others.  Band mates are a lot more intimate than coworkers and the such.  Not only do you spend a lot of time together, but you also inherit their personalities, habits, feelings, moods, etc, while working with them and the output depends on making it all work in a musical context.  As a drummer, you have to be able to lock in with the bass player or its a huge fail.  I've played with a bunch of people in which we wanted to kill each other after playing.  The music got played, but there was no way I was going to hang out with them afterwards.  When relationships become that toxic, people tend to distance themselves from each other.
